Mary Morrissy was born in Dublin in 1957. She has published a collection of stories, A LAZY EYE, and two novels, MOTHER OF PEARL and THE PRETENDER. She won the Hennessey award in 1984, a Lannan Literary Award in 1995 and was shortlisted for the Whitbread Prize in 1996. Morrissy, who lives in Ireland, has worked as a journalist and fiction reviewer, and has taught in creative writing programs at the Universities of Arkansas and Iowa. She has recently been awarded a one-year fellowship at the New York Public Library, where she is working on a new novel.
